by, then the order by IS group BY, have, order by.C. In the Select column, if there are columns, expressions, and grouping functions, the columns and expressions must appear in the GROUP BY clause, or an error will occur.Using GROUP BY is not a precondition for having a having.3. Multi-Table QuerySql>select e.name,e.sal,d.dname from EMP E, dept D WHERE E.deptno=d.deptno ORDER by D.deptno;Sql>select E.ename,e.sal,s.grade from EMP e,salgrade s wher e.s
complete this task in versions earlier than version 2nd, you usually need to use SQL/XML to generate functions, such as xmlelement, xmlforest, and xmldetail (). In Oracle Database 10GIn version 2nd, XQuery will be more efficient than these functions. Specifically, using the ora: View XQuery function within an XQuery expression, you can query existing Relational
When querying by page in oracle, you may encounter data duplication problems. The following describes how to solve the data duplication problem in oracle paging query, hoping to help you.
In oracle paging query, we use a widely recognized and efficient database paging
1: When multiple table associations are used, the multiple where statement minimizes the result set of a single table, uses aggregate functions to summarize the result set, and then associates with other tables to minimize the amount of result set data 2: You should consider the possibility of using a right connection when you are associating two tables. To improve query speed3: Use where instead of having , where is used to filter rows, and having is
exist. Although it is not specified when you create a table, some internal fields added to Oracle for maintenance are, these fields can be used as common files.The most familiar pseudo-column is rowid, which is equivalent to a pointer pointing to the position of the record on the disk. Ora_rowscn is newly added to Oracle 10 Gb. It is regarded as the SCN of the last modified record. The flashback version
disk I/O, resulting in slow query. If the execution plan stability is not used, analyze both the table and index, which may directly increase the query speed. The analysis table command can use analyze table to analyze indexes. You can use the analyze Index Command. For tables with less than 1 million, you can analyze the entire table. For large tables, you can analyze them by percentage, but the percentag
-----------------------------------------------------------------Why? Chinese Input Test finds that the queried data is no longer normal because these Chinese characters are stored in the ZHS16GBK encoding format. However, after you query the data, convert it according to the Oracle Customer Service Code (UTF8, and converted to the UTF8 encoding format, but the operating system is simplified Chinese (GB2312
Pq_distribute hints are often used to improve the performance of connection operations between partitioned tables in the Data Warehouse. The Pq_distribute hint allows you to determine how table data rows participating in a connection are allocated between production and consumption parallel query service processes. Pq_distribute prompt accepts three parameters: table name, outer allocation, and internal allocation.When parallel
Tags: integer table can also be between output UI sha off row migration[ Oracle-based SQL Optimization ] Oracle-based SQL optimization "Bo Master" Gao Ruilin "Blog Address" http://www.cnblogs.com/grl214
A. Written Intent Description
In the early stage of the system development, due to les
Oracle cold, stay at home and read the "Mastering Oracle SQL" 2nd, found that Oracle's function is still very strong, there are 200 optical functions, hsql is difficult to match. The next stubborn, it seems either to risk using Hibernate3.0 SQL mapping function, or to run the JDBC assembly VO. 1. Report Totals dedicate
SmallProgramGrowth of SQL Server Cognition
1. I don't have to graduate or work for a long time. I only know the relationship between SQL and SQL Server Oracle and MySQL. I usually think that SQL is SQL Server.
2. after several
consistency of the constraints of the record.
2. As of scn:
We use the dbms_flashback.get_system_change_number function to obtain the current scn of oracle, and then execute the data modification operation.
SQL> select dbms_flashback.get_system_change_number from dual;GET_SYSTEM_CHANGE_NUMBER------------------------14229608
Delete data:
SQL
Tags: Oracle where generalSQL query statement describes the--select statement1. Simple SELECT query statement1.1 Check.Sql> select * from EMP;1.2 Check ListSql> select Empno,ename from emp;1.3 Related queriesSyntax for Oracle:Select a.*,b.* from emp a,dept b where a.deptno=b.deptno;General Syntax:Select a.*,b.* from emp a joins Dept b on (a.deptno = B.deptno);1.4
for language settings. If the character set is zhs16gbk, The nls_lang can be American_America.zhs16gbk.
Involves three character sets,
1. Character Set on the El server side;
2. Character Set of oracle client;
3. dmp file character set.
During data import, the three character sets must be consistent before the data can be correctly imported.
2.1 query character sets on
. Currently, this parameter is not supported.And 17.3.2.1. rules and restrictions on using Stored Procedures
To use stored procedures in hibernate, you must follow some rules. stored procedures that do not follow these rules will not be available. If you still want to use them, you mustSession. Connection ()These rules apply to different databases because database providers have different stored procedure syntax and semantics.
Query of stored proce
As a little programmer, it is inevitable to deal with where in and like in daily development, in most cases, the parameters we pass are not much simple, single quotation marks, sensitive characters escape, and then directly spelled into the SQL, execute the query, done. If one day you inevitably need to improve the SQL query
cannot create a database structure.Connect: A user with connect permission can only log on to Oracle, not create an entity, and cannot create a database structure.For normal users: Grant Connect, resource permissions.For DBA administration users: Grant Connect,resource, dba authority.System Permission Authorization command:System permissions can only be granted by the DBA User: sys, system (only two users at the beginning)Authorization Command:sql> G
and 123456 passwordC:\>sqlplus scott/123456Exit Sqlplus Environmentsql:\>exit;Query all tables under the Scott userSELECT * from tab;Query who the current user isShow user;Set the displayed column width (character, date), 10 characters wide, a for the character typeCol ename for A12;A12: Indicates a display width of 12 characters, a case insensitiveExecutes the most recent
the rownum=2 results. Since rownum are all starting from 1, but more than 1 of the natural numbers in rownum do equal to the judgment is considered false condition, so can not find rownum = N (n>1 natural number).Sql> Select Rownum,id,name from student where rownum=1; (You can use a limit to return the number of records to ensure no errors, such as: implicit cursors)Sql> Select Rownum,id,name from student
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.